71 Seasons Ago Clemson Football Finished 5-5 in 1954

20

Jun 20, 2025, 12:00 AM
Reply

The season might not have been perfect. But the season is still VERY noteworthy:
- The Tiger makes his first appearance at a game!!
- Clemson begins firing a cannon after each score!!

Overview:

According to Wikipedia:

“The 1954 Clemson Tigers football team was an American football team that represented Clemson College in the Atlantic Coast Conference (ACC) during the 1954 college football season. In its 15th season under head coach Frank Howard, the team compiled a 5–5 record (1–2 against conference opponents), finished fifth in the ACC, and outscored opponents by a total of 193 to 121.”

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/1954_Clemson_Tigers_football_team

Clemson Head Coach Frank Howard:


https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Frank_Howard_(American_football)


Worthy of Note:

According to ClemsonWiki:

“The Tiger mascot appears on the Clemson sidelines for the first time. He joins the Country Gentleman, a Clemson representative since 1939.”

https://clemsonwiki.com/wiki/1954


The Tiger:



And according to ClemsonTigers.com:

“Sept. 18, 1954 – Clemson Head Cheerleader George Bennett fired a cannon after each Tiger score. The cannon was purchased by Bennett’s father and the tradition is still carried out today.

Oct. 9, 1954 – Clemson upset 14th ranked Florida in Jacksonville, 14-7.”

https://clemsontigers.com/clemson-football-historical-timeline/


And Wikipedia adds the following:

“Buck George, Scott Jackson, Mark Kane, and Clyde White were the team captains. The team's statistical leaders included quarterback Don King with 468 passing yards, halfback Joel Wells with 352 rushing yards, and halfback Jim Coleman with 31 points (5 touchdowns, 1 extra point).

Three Clemson players were also named to the 1954 All-South Carolina football team: back Don King, end Scott Jackson, and tackle Clyde White.”

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/1954_Clemson_Tigers_football_team

As for Clemson QB Don King:

According to ClemsonTigers.com:

King led the Tigers in passing for four straight years and in rushing in 1953. He was the first Clemson player to lead the Tigers in passing four consecutive years. It is an accomplishment that has been equaled only by Nealon Greene (1994-97) and Charlie Whitehurst (2002-05) since.

https://clemsontigers.com/former-tiger-don-king-passes-away/

Here is a different image of Clemson Football Legend Don King from the previous images:

Image from: https://www.ebay.com/itm/354813140015


Results:

September 18: Presbyterian* W 33–0
September 25: at Georgia* L 7–14
October 2: VPI* L 7–18
October 9: vs. No. 14 Florida* (Jacksonville) W 14–7
October 21: at South Carolina L 8–13
October 30: vs. Wake Forest W 32–20
November 6: Furman* W 27–6
November 13: at No. 17 Maryland L 0–16
November 20: at No. 18 Auburn* L 6–27
November 27: The Citadel* W 59–0

I do like seeing that nice win against Florida in Jacksonville!

With the loss in Columbia, Clemson’s record in the series with the Gamechickens falls to 29-20-3. Having won a mere 20 of the 52 games played between Clemson and South Carolina, this was as close to Clemson as the Chickens would EVER become.

Also in 1954:

According to ClemsonWiki:

“Lake Issaqueena is drained for ecological renewal and numerous sand-filled M38A2 100-pound Practice Bombs are seen in the lake bottom, left from the use of the World War II Issaqueena Bombing Range. The exposed bombs are disposed of in 1955. The lake is not completely drained and therefore the possibility of additional practice bombs in deeper portions of the lake exists.”

Todays player spotlight is #71 Tristan Leigh. He is a graduate senior offensive linemen for the 2025 Clemson Tigers.

Tristan is a “Former five-star recruit who assumed a starting role in 2023 … enters 2025 having played 1,587 offensive snaps over 32 career games (23 starts).”

Out of high school, Tristan was “One of the highest rated offensive linemen in the nation … ranked in the top 25 among all prospects by Rivals.com, ESPN.com and 247Sports … listed as the No. 15 overall player and a five-star prospect by 247Sports, which also ranked him as the fourth-best offensive tackle in the nation and second-best player from Virginia … Rivals.com listed him as the 17th-best overall player, the fourth-best offensive tackle and top player from Virginia … ESPN.com ranked him No. 22 overall as well as the fourth-best offensive tackle and the second-best player from Virginia … PrepStar five-star recruit and Top 150 Dream Team selection who ranked as the nation’s No. 34 overall recruit, including ranking as the No. 2 offensive tackle prospect and No. 2 player in Virginia”. He was apparently a 2 way player in high school. He was a OL and DT but chose to focus on being a left tackle once he left for college. He also played basketball in high school as well.

“His father, Stan Leigh, played running back at Virginia from 1990-94 … his mother, Laura Rigney, graduated from Virginia and George Mason/George Washington School of Medicine and serves as a family nurse practitioner“.

Lutetium (Lu) is a rare earth element with a variety of specialized applications, particularly in the medical and industrial sectors.
Here are some of the main uses of lutetium:

Medical Applications:

Targeted Cancer Therapy: The radioactive isotope Lutetium-177 (Lu-177) is crucial in nuclear medicine for targeted radionuclide therapy (TRT). It's used to treat certain cancers like prostate cancer and neuroendocrine tumors by attaching to specific molecules or antibodies that target cancer cells. This allows for the precise delivery of radiation to the tumor, minimizing damage to surrounding healthy tissue.

Medical Imaging: Lutetium-based compounds, like lutetium oxyorthosilicate (LSO) and lutetium-yttrium oxyorthosilicate (LYSO) crystals, are vital components in Positron Emission Tomography

(PET) scanners. Their high density and effective atomic number contribute to enhanced image resolution and diagnostic accuracy.

Bone Pain Palliation: Lu-177-EDTMP has been shown to be effective in relieving bone pain in patients with metastatic prostate and breast carcinomas.

Industrial Applications:

Catalysis: Lutetium finds application in petroleum refining as a catalyst for cracking hydrocarbons. This process helps to break down heavy crude oil into more valuable, lighter components.

Specialized Materials: Lutetium is used in the production of advanced ceramics and metal alloys to improve their properties like strength and corrosion resistance. Lutetium-stabilized zirconia, for instance, is utilized in high-temperature applications like thermal barrier coatings.

Phosphors: Lutetium oxide is used in the production of phosphors for fluorescent lighting and in scintillation crystals for radiation detection. Lutetium-based phosphors are also employed in advanced LED technologies.

High-Refractive-Index Glass: Lutetium is used in the production of high-refractive-index glass, which is important for specialized optical lenses and laser systems.

Dating Meteorites: The radioactive isotope Lutetium-176 (Lu-176) is used in dating meteorites to determine their age relative to Earth.

In essence, lutetium plays a significant role in various high-tech and specialized fields, particularly in the medical and industrial sectors, contributing to advancements in cancer treatment, medical imaging, and advanced materials development.
